A112030 (2 + (-1)^n) * (-1)^floor(n/2). +0
8
3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1, -3, -1, 3, 1 (list; graph; listen)
OFFSET

0,1

COMMENT

a(n) = A010684(n+1) * (-1)^floor(n/2);

the fractions A112031(n)/A112032(n) give the partial sums of a(n)/floor((n+4)/2).

FORMULA

O.g.f.: (3+x)/(1+x^2) . - R. J. Mathar (mathar(AT)strw.leidenuniv.nl), Jan 09 2008
